System.ArgumentOutOfRangeException: 索引和長度必須引用該字符串內的位置。 參數名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ind()
【技術實現步驟摘要】
本申請涉及人工智能,特別是涉及一種近距空戰訓練系統構建方法及裝置。
技術介紹
1、當今世界形勢復雜多變,隨之而言的是戰爭對國防安全的威脅與考驗。對此,各國都在積極提升自己的軍事實力。其中空軍在戰爭中是不可忽視的力量,有時對一場戰爭中能起到一錘定音的勝負效果。但是目前空戰訓練受到場地,天氣,人員,裝備等種種因素的影響,訓練比較低效。與此同時,隨著戰機的不斷演化升級,其操作難度越來越高,對飛行員的要求也來越高,因此,如何打造一個智能化的對戰飛行訓練系統成為本領域亟需解決的技術問題。
技術實現思路
1、基于上述問題,本申請提供了一種近距空戰訓練系統構建方法及裝置,可以構建出一個智能化的對戰飛行訓練系統。
2、本申請實施例公開了如下技術方案:
3、一方面,本申請實施例提供了一種近距空戰訓練系統構建方法,包括:
4、構建包含有飛行控制系統、空氣動力學系統、雷達探測系統和毀傷判斷系統的飛行仿真系統;
5、基于所述飛行仿真系統采集的數據,對智能體訓練架構進行訓練;
6、利用所述智能體訓練架構構建近距空戰訓練系統,以根據訓練者操縱的飛行器的飛行狀態以及對手的飛行器的飛行狀態,對態勢進行評估。
7、可選的,所述飛行控制系統、空氣動力學系統、雷達探測系統和毀傷判斷系統,包括:
8、飛行控制系統,用于對飛行狀態進行控制;
9、空氣動力學系統,用于根據空氣動力學原理模擬飛行狀態;
10、雷達探測系統
11、毀傷判斷系統,用于對自身以及其他飛行體的毀傷程度進行判斷。
12、可選的,所述智能體訓練架構,具體包括:
13、通過神經網絡驅動決策智能體與飛行仿真系統進行不斷交互產生數據;
14、利用產生的數據不斷進行訓練,從而提升由神經網絡驅動決策的智能體所產生的動作指令。
15、可選的,所述方法還包括:
16、將狀態輸入映射到函數值上;
17、通過不斷和環境進行交互以生成交互數據;
18、通過對所述交互數據進行反向傳播,以優化神經網絡參數。
19、可選的,所述方法還包括:
20、根據評估結果輸出動作指令;
21、基于所述動作指令調整對手飛行器的飛行狀態。
22、另一方面,本申請實施例提供了一種近距空戰訓練系統構建裝置,包括:
23、構建模塊,用于構建包含有飛行控制系統、空氣動力學系統、雷達探測系統和毀傷判斷系統的飛行仿真系統;
24、智能體訓練架構訓練模塊,用于基于所述飛行仿真系統采集的數據,對智能體訓練架構進行訓練;
25、近距空戰訓練系統構建模塊,用于利用所述智能體訓練架構構建近距空戰訓練系統,以根據訓練者操縱的飛行器的飛行狀態以及對手的飛行器的飛行狀態,對態勢進行評估。
26、可選的,所述構建模塊,包括:
27、飛行控制系統,用于對飛行狀態進行控制;
28、空氣動力學系統,用于根據空氣動力學原理模擬飛行狀態;
29、雷達探測系統,用于根據模擬飛行過程中多個飛行體之間的狀態對雷達探測信號進行模擬;
30、毀傷判斷系統,用于對自身以及其他飛行體的毀傷程度進行判斷。
31、可選的,所述近距空戰訓練系統構建模塊,具體包括:
32、數據交互子模塊,用于通過神經網絡驅動決策智能體與飛行仿真系統進行不斷交互產生數據;
33、模型訓練子模塊,用于利用產生的數據不斷進行訓練,從而提升由神經網絡驅動決策的智能體所產生的動作指令。
34、可選的,所述裝置還包括:
35、函數映射子模塊,用于將狀態輸入映射到函數值上;
36、數據獲取子模塊,用于通過不斷和環境進行交互以生成交互數據;
37、神經網絡參數優化子模塊,用于通過對所述交互數據進行反向傳播,以優化神經網絡參數。
38、可選的,所述裝置還包括:
39、指令輸出模塊,用于根據評估結果輸出動作指令;
40、基于所述動作指令調整對手飛行器的飛行狀態。
41、較于現有技術,本申請具有以下有益效果:
42、本申請提供的一種近距空戰訓練系統構建方法,包括:構建包含有飛行控制系統、空氣動力學系統、雷達探測系統和毀傷判斷系統的飛行仿真系統;基于所述飛行仿真系統采集的數據,對智能體訓練架構進行訓練;利用所述智能體訓練架構構建近距空戰訓練系統,以根據訓練者操縱的飛行器的飛行狀態以及對手的飛行器的飛行狀態,對態勢進行評估。所構建出的近距空戰訓練系統提供了接近真實作戰的環境的仿真環境,有效模擬真實戰場環境,有助于飛行的訓練和開發輔助飛行訓練系統,可以作為僚機或者對手與人類飛行員進行配合和對戰訓練,也可以與人類飛行員共乘一架飛機進行輔助決策,也可以單對操作一架飛機實現無人作戰。
本文檔來自技高網...【技術保護點】
1.一種近距空戰訓練系統構建方法,其特征在于,包括:
2.根據權利要求1所述的方法,其特征在于,所述飛行控制系統、空氣動力學系統、雷達探測系統和毀傷判斷系統,包括:
3.根據權利要求1所述的方法,其特征在于,所述智能體訓練架構,具體包括:
4.根據權利要求3所述的方法,其特征在于,所述方法還包括:
5.根據權利要求1所述的方法,其特征在于,所述方法還包括:
6.一種近距空戰訓練系統構建裝置,其特征在于,包括:
7.根據權利要求6所述的裝置,其特征在于,所述構建模塊,包括:
8.根據權利要求6所述的裝置,其特征在于,所述近距空戰訓練系統構建模塊,具體包括:
9.根據權利要求8所述的裝置,其特征在于,所述裝置還包括:
10.根據權利要求6所述的裝置,其特征在于,所述裝置還包括:
【技術特征摘要】
1.一種近距空戰訓練系統構建方法,其特征在于,包括:
2.根據權利要求1所述的方法,其特征在于,所述飛行控制系統、空氣動力學系統、雷達探測系統和毀傷判斷系統,包括:
3.根據權利要求1所述的方法,其特征在于,所述智能體訓練架構,具體包括:
4.根據權利要求3所述的方法,其特征在于,所述方法還包括:
5.根據權利要求1所述的方法,其特征在于,所述方...
【專利技術屬性】
技術研發人員:黃安付,高超,龍海濤,郭偉,
申請(專利權)人:白楊時代北京科技有限公司,
類型:發明
國別省市:
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。